5.0 out of 5 stars great, but takes getting used to, February 13, 2008
This review is from: Bosch Axxis Series : WTE86300US 24 Condenser Electric Tumble Dryer
We live in a brownstone in New York City with no ventilation in our cellar for a conventional dryer. We've had the Bosch for 2 years. Bosch makes one of the few condensation dryers with the capacity to dry large loads. It takes about 45-60 minutes to dry a standard load of shirts and socks. Large bedspreads take about twice as long. It's a lot slower the conventional dryers, but it does the job. It is easier on fabrics because it simply pulls moisture from the chamber instead of blasting clothes with hot air. My clothes seem to hold color better. It's expensive, but fine if you don't mind the wait.

The outlet for this dryer is not conventional. It's not a big deal (inexpensive) to get an electrician out to switch it, but that will be a small added cost.

We inherited a new Bosch HE washer/condenser dryer set with our house. We were so excited! Don't have to go buy new appliances! But now I know why they left them here.

The dryer condenser is not well designed. It is flat, so the condensate doesn't drain well. Then it becomes full of water, then it stops condensing, then the clothes don't get dry. I literally take this out between every load to clean out the condensed water, and I still have to air dry it completely every 3-4 loads or it just won't work. Plus, lint gets in the metal condenser and it's almost impossible to clean out. I've tried pipe cleaners and towels and chopsticks.... it's about a food long and has closely spaced plates of metal ridges for surface area for condensing. The thing is, the lint travels through on the air and gets stuck on the metal ridges. Then because it is so long and the plates are so close together, it's almost impossible to clean. It should be snap-together or something so you can open it up to get the lint out. But it's not. My best solution so far is to take used dryer sheets and run them through with chopsticks. It takes at least half an hour to get most of the lint out, and it's tedious and unnecessary.

The front vent is difficult to open to clean as well. Also, because it's not designed to vent to a duct to go outside, the water condenses in your laundry area (for us, a closet with doors).

All-around poor design. Full of frustration. I got a set of HE stackable washer/dryer from Sears, the Kenmore brand. Better warranty and works great. More features, same size. Also, since I got it on sale, cheaper. Go to a brick and mortar store and save yourself some grief.
